3rd February, 2009 Warrington Anglers Association Guardian Notes

After having to contend with second place on last weeks Trent & Mersey match Kev Green showed that this was only a temporary lapse by taking first place on the same venue on Sunday. He had an all roach catch for 3-6-2 but Mick Cullen who beat him twice the previous week must have thought he had a bye as he failed to show! Man of the match must go to junior member Jack Bellis who pitted himself against some top notch senior anglers to take fourth place. In the future he could well be set to join an elite group of Warrington AA ex juniors who have fished for their country. Roach made up the majority of catches taken on punch bread or pinkie.

On the Bridgewater Canal a few small pike around five or six pounds are reported from the Agden area, best fish was 12-8-0 caught by Dan Taylor on legered sprat. Otherwise sport is not at its best and only the hardiest of anglers are venturing out.

The National Federation of Anglers (NW) which is still operating under this banner until the Angling Trust assesses the regional re-organisation is to run a series of qualifiers for inclusion into the disabled match team that will represent the region in the national championships. The qualifier dates are, 26th Feb, 5th, 12th, and 19th March which are to be held at Partridge Lakes, Culcheth, Warrington. The matches are point based with the best 3 out of 4 results to count. They are open to individual members of the Angling Trust or like ourselves members of clubs who are. Further details from John Moore (NFA Regional/ Angling Trust Officer for Disabled Tel 01204 412397).

There is no Mersey match this weekend as water conditions could be horrendous with snow melt water from the upper reaches. Match organiser Bob Campbell will assess the situation for the following weeks and may transfer some events to Appleton Reservoir.
